Jean Henri Dunant (1828-1910), a visionary Swiss philanthropist, is shown here as a shielding Switzerland, symbolizing the protection and care he brought to the world through the founding of the International Red Cross in 1863. In 1901, along with Frederic Passy (1825-1912), Dunant was awarded the first Nobel Peace Prize for their humanitarian efforts.
